About This Lot

As of January 2024

Classic western Maine mountain lot with approx 6,000' of frontage on Mt. Blue Stream AND amazing views of the surrounding mountains including: Mt Blue, Mt Abraham & Saddleback Mountain in the distance & Spruce, Day & Bean mountains close by. The improved access road gets you off Route 4/Rangeley Road & into the property. The topography varies from extremely steep along the banks of Mt Blue Stream to rolling topography in the interior portions reaching an elevation of just over 940'. Plenty of wildlife signs and recent cutting have created forest edges where wildlife can thrive. Mt Blue Stream, originating from Mt Blue Pond, affords some great fishing for wild Brook Trout. The setting along Mt Blue Stream, although quite steep in places, is amazing and very picturesque. Most of the lot has been harvested leaving behind vigorous stands of young growing trees along with mature well-wooded areas between the harvested sections. This desirable tract is located less than 15 miles from Farmington and just under 30 miles from Rangeley. Rangeley, to the north, offers some of the best outdoor experiences found in northern New England. There is just over one mile of frontage on Route 4 with power. Outdoor activities nearby include fishing and recreating on the Sandy River, Atv trails and of course snowmobiling. Sandy River, just on the other side of Route 4 from this property offers good paddling and some good sections of whitewater rapids. From the nearby town of Strong at Devil's Elbow along Rt 4 is a great location to start an 11-mile paddling journey thru several Class II rapids on your way to Farmington. The historic Fly Rod Crosby 45-mile hiking trail is nearby and steeped in history of the famous fisherwoman and Maine' first registered guide, Cornelia ''Fly Rod'' Crosby. The 8,000-acre Mt Blue State Park is nearby offering miles of hiking trails, snowmobiling, snowshoeing, cross-country skiing & access to Webb Lake. Map R4 Lot 14 IS in Tree Growth
